A Victorian diamond set cinquefoil cluster brooch,with an old European cut diamond in a cut down collet to the centre, surrounded by cushion-shaped, cushion cut, old Swiss cut and old eight cut diamonds. The lobes similarly set with a blade edge bar to each centre, with a cushion cut diamond in a cut down collet. Fleur-de-lys diamond clusters between each lobe, all in silver cut down collets and backed in gold. Brooch pin and roller catch. A case by 'D&J Wellby Ltd. Garrick Street, London'. Tested as approximately 18ct gold and silver. 38 x 38mm, 9.63g

A Victorian diamond and demantoid garnet bow brooch, c.1890,with an old European cut diamond in a cut down collet at the centre. Ribbon loops to each side, set alternately with old European cut diamonds and Swiss cut garnets, with ribbon tails and old European cut diamonds, in cut down collet to blade edge bars, radiating from the centre. All set in silver and backed in gold. Later revolving catch. 5.24g, 400mm long

A late Victorian diamond set crescent brooch or fourcher, c.1890.The closed crescent with a row of old European, old Swiss cut and rose cut diamonds, all claw set to silver cut down collets, with a scalloped gallery and two row under bezel. Plain pin and 'C' catch with threaded option for an alternative. Fitting deficient. Tested as approximately 15ct gold and silver. 23mm x 23mm, 3.72g
A late Victorian diamond set brooch/pendant or tiara centrepiece, c.1890,of open scrolling pear-shaped form with an old European cut diamond in a cut down collet to the centre, with a cushion cut diamond below. Scrolling blade edge bars with reeds, leaves and laurel, all grain set with graduated old European cut, old Swiss cut, old eight cut and rose cut diamonds. A detachable brooch fitting with pairs of pendant hooks. A hand engraved inventory or part number '69'. All set in silver and backed in gold. Tested as sterling silver backed with 15ct gold, pin 9ct gold. 47 x 44mm, 11.30g
